首页 新闻 论坛 群组 Blog 文档 下载 读书 Tag 网摘 搜索 .NET Java 游戏 视频 人才 外包 培训 数据库 书店 程序员
中国软件网
欢迎您:游客 | 登录 注册 帮助
  • Dynamips@Edurainbow 2.72使用方法和学习项目1 [已结帖,结帖人:T5500]
    进入用户个人空间
    加为好友
    发送私信
    在线聊天
    • merryboy
    • 等级:
    • 可用分等级:
    • 总技术分:
    • 总技术分排名:
    • 结帖率:
    发表于:2008-08-20 14:00:43 楼主
    理解:
    Dynamips.exe    是一个后台系统模拟程序,启动各式各样的 路由器(R)(Router),交换机(SW)(Switch),PC机(PC)(Personal Computer)。
    dynagen.exe      是启动设备命令的地方,start,stop,reload,list有这个界面来运行。
    DynamipsController.exe 是工大瑞普开发的一个基于.NET(需要安装.NET Framework 2.5以上版本)的C/S程序,它就是一个界面,来启动按钮对应的.cmd文件(.cmd文件内部包含dynagen + net文件启动方法),它可以用,也可以不用,你可以直接启动安装好的.cmd文件。
    .cmd文件        是一组来启动dynagen + net文件的类似bat(批处理)文件方式的启动文件。
    .net文件        是一组配置各个设备的连接方式和设备类型的文件,摸索中发现,这里才是各个设备连接接口的配置位置,以前不知道各个设备是怎么连接在一起的,看了这个文件才知道设备是怎么具体连接哪个口的。

    第一种使用方法:
    1、按照 Edurainbow\Dynamips@Edurainbow Full2 Update 7.2 独立安装包\使用指南.pdf 的文档来操作。
    先在 setup文件夹下配置 1 2 号两个文件,看文档
    再是(鼠标双击)启动 0.虚拟服务Dynamips-XP&2003.cmd (我的系统是xp哈),不用关闭(可以最小化这个窗口),随后(鼠标双击)启动 1.控制台NA路由版.cmd,使用 start命令启动R1
    具体指令如下:
    list
    start R1
    stop R1
    start /all
    stop /all
    start R1
    reload R1
    capture R1 f0/0 example.cap
    2、保持现有窗口状态,使用如下工具可以访问路由器1(R1)
    a、cmd--> telnet localhost 3001
    b、cmd--> putty - telnet localhost 3001  (需要把\bin\putty下的putty.exe拷贝到windows\system32下才能用这个工具)
    c、安装 SecureCRT选择协议时要选择telnet,主机名localhost,端口号3001,连接就是了。


    第二种使用方法:
    这种方法会遇到现
    一个应用程序错误的对话框"应用程序正常初始化(0xc0000135)失败"
    的错误,这是因为没有安装.NET环境造成的。
    安装.NET 1.0 Formwork是不行的,需要安装2.5以上的版本,我安装的是3.5的版本,即.NET 3.5 Formwork
    下载地址是:http://download.microsoft.com/download/6/0/f/60fc5854-3cb8-4892-b6db-bd4f42510f28/dotnetfx35.exe
    197.12MB有点大哈。
    安装的时候,程序自动连接网络下载东东(73MB),真搞不懂,还要下什么。
    装好后,就能使用GUI的方式,这里看来,GUI的方式只是一个窗口,实际调用的是第一种方法中的各个程序。

    ************以下是练习****************************
    启动控制台NA路由版
    启动R1:start R1,然后用SecureCRT登录到R1上,(连接localhost,端口号3001,取名字为R1)
    学习项目1: 用户模式与特权模式交换
    Router> enable                      //从用户模式进入特权模式
    Router# disable                      //退出特权模式
    Router>

    学习项目2: 查看本机上的TELNET会话
    Router> enable                      //从用户模式进入特权模式
    Router# show sessions              //查看本机上的TELNET会话
    Router# disable                      //退出特权模式
    Router>

    学习项目3: 关闭所有的TELNET会话
    Router> enable                      //从用户模式进入特权模式
    Router# disconnect                //关闭所有的TELNET会话
    Router# disable                      //退出特权模式
    Router>

    学习项目4: 删除NVRAM中的配置
    Router> enable              //从用户模式进入特权模式
    Router# erase startup-config     //删除NVRAM中的配置
    Router# disable                      //退出特权模式
    Router>

    学习项目5: 重启路由器
    Router> enable              //从用户模式进入特权模式
    Router# reload                   //重启路由器
    Router# disable                      //退出特权模式
    Router>

    学习项目6: 进入系统配置模式,并退出
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)# end                  //退出系统配置模式
    Router#
    Router# configure terminal          //进入系统配置模式
    Router(config)# exit                //退出系统配置模式
    Router#                         
    Router# onfigure terminal            //进入系统配置模式
    Router(config)# Ctrl+z              //退出系统配置模式
    Router#                         
    Router# onfigure terminal            //进入系统配置模式
    Router(config)# Ctrl+c              //退出系统配置模式
    Router#   
    Router# disable                      //退出特权模式
    Router>

    学习项目7: 配置用户名为GPS
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)# hostname GPS
    GPS(config)# exit
    GPS# exit
    GPS>                                //后面的例子,我是把名字改回来的

    学习项目8:配置开机话语
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#banner welcome        //配置开机话语
    Router(config)# exit                //退出系统配置模式
    Router# exit
    Router>

    学习项目9:查看物理层信息
    Router> enable              //从用户模式进入特权模式
    Router# show controllers            //查看串口0的物理层信息
    Router# disable                      //退出特权模式
    Router>

    学习项目10:查看系统配置信息
    Router> enable              //从用户模式进入特权模式
    Router# sh run                      //查看系统配置信息
    全称
    Router# show run                    //查看系统配置信息
    Router# show running-config          //查看系统配置信息 这个才是最全的命令

    学习项目11:查看端口的IP配置信息
    Router> enable              //从用户模式进入特权模式
    Router# show ip interface            //查看端口的IP配置信息
    Router# disable                      //退出特权模式
    Router>

    学习项目12:查看主机表
    Router> enable              //从用户模式进入特权模式
    Router# show hosts                  //查看主机表
    Router# disable                      //退出特权模式
    Router>

    学习项目13:关闭动态域名解析
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#no ip domain-lookup  //关闭动态域名解析
    Router(config)# exit                //退出系统配置模式
    Router# exit
    Router>

    学习项目14:打开动态域名解析
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#ip domain-lookup  //打开动态域名解析
    Router(config)# exit                //退出系统配置模式
    Router# exit
    Router>

    学习项目15:打开动态域名解析之后便可以指定DNS服务
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#ip name-server 202.106.0.20  //打开动态域名解析之后便可以指定DNS服务
    Router(config)# exit                //退出系统配置模式
    Router# exit
    Router>

    学习项目16:查看CDP邻居信息
    Router> enable              //从用户模式进入特权模式
    Router# show cdp neighbors          //查看CDP邻居信息
    Router# disable                      //退出特权模式
    Router>

    学习项目17:查看路由表,可以看到以C打头的路由信息,这是直连的路由信息;可以看到R开头的路由信息,是从rip学来的路由信息;可看到以I开头的路由信息取代了以R开头的路由信息,这是因为igrp的管理距离是100,小于rip的120
    Router> enable              //从用户模式进入特权模式
    Router# show ip route         
    Router# disable                      //退出特权模式
    Router>

    学习项目18:启动RIP路由协议
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#router rip       
    Router(config-router)#network 10.0.0.0 //发布网段。注意network后面是接的网络号,而不是IP地址
    Router(config-router)#     
    Router# disable                      //退出特权模式
    Router>

    学习项目19:查看配置的路由协议
    Router> enable              //从用户模式进入特权模式
    Router# show ip protocol            //查看配置的路由协议
    Router# disable                      //退出特权模式
    Router>

    学习项目20:一定要注意在IGRP后面加自治系统号,考试的时候题目会告诉你AS NUMBER,照敲就是
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#router igrp 300
    Router(config-router)#
    Router# disable                      //退出特权模式
    Router>

    学习项目21:进入虚拟线程配置模式,在这个模式里可对telnet功能进行配置,配置telnet密码,默认的网络设备telnet的功能是关闭的,配了密码之后会自动打开
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#line vty 0 4          //进入虚拟线程配置模式,在这个模式里可对telnet功能进行配置
    Router(config-line)#login
    Router(config-line)#password cisco  //配置telnet密码,默认的网络设备telnet的功能是关闭的,配了密码之后会自动打开
    Router(config-line)#exit
    Router(config)#enable password cisco //配置进入enable模式的密码, 区分大小写
    Router# disable                      //退出特权模式
    Router>

    学习项目22:
    Router> enable              //从用户模式进入特权模式
    Router# configure terminal          //进入系统配置模式
    Router(config)#line console 0
    Router(config-line)#login
    Router(config-line)#password cisco  //配置进入用户模式的密码
    Router(config-line)#logging synchronous //输入同步
    Router(config-line)#exec-timeout 0 0 //禁止因为一段时间没有输入而跳出
    Router(config-line)#Ctrl+Z
    Router# disable                      //退出特权模式
    Router>


    来源于网络,回归于网络。
    我的邮箱:happy.every.day@126.com QQ:48399956
    快乐!
    2008年8月17日
    0  修改 删除 举报 引用 回复

    网站简介广告服务网站地图帮助联系方式诚聘英才English 问题报告
    北京创新乐知广告有限公司 版权所有 京 ICP 证 070598 号
    世纪乐知(北京)网络技术有限公司 提供技术支持
    Copyright © 2000-2008, CSDN.NET, All Rights Reserved